In the contemporary landscape of urban planning and municipal governance, the integration of digital tools has become a pivotal strategy for fostering community engagement, enhancing service delivery, and competing in a rapidly digitalising world. As cities seek to transform themselves into **smart cities**, one of the emergent trends involves deploying dedicated mobile applications that connect citizens directly with their local authorities. Such digital platforms serve as a bridge, facilitating transparent communication, real-time information dissemination, and participatory decision-making processes.

The Strategic Significance of Mobile City Engagement Platforms

Urban environments are complex ecosystems where efficient management hinges on real-time data and active citizen participation. According to recent industry reports, over 65% of city councils across the United Kingdom now deploy some form of digital engagement app, aiming to create more responsive governance models. These apps not only streamline reporting of issues such as potholes, graffiti, or broken streetlights but also enable citizens to access information about local events, transport updates, and city initiatives at their fingertips.

A landmark study by Urban Planning Journal (2023) demonstrated that cities utilizing dedicated engagement apps observed a 30% increase in civic participation and a 22% reduction in administrative response times. This data underscores the transformative potential of mobile apps in democratizing urban governance and fostering community resilience.
